Storage places range from a free space in your parents' garage, through several types of self-storage units, to specialist removal and storage companies.
The main factors to consider when you decide to store items are cost, convenience, duration of storage, accessibility; security and insurance.

For any type of self-storage facility you will need to pack your smaller items into easily stacked containers and, especially if you are going to require access, plan the arrangement of larger items such as furniture, white goods or office equipment within the storage space.
If you opt for specialist storage services, companies will supply boxes, crates, man-power and transport. Storage units are available for rental. Full insurance cover may be taken for valuable items.
